

A major tragedy unfolded in Vietnam after a tourist boat capsized in Ha Long Bay at around 10:30 a.m., reportedly due to rough sea conditions and high waves. The accident claimed the lives of more than 15 people, while several others were reported missing. Among the victims were tourists from the Indian states of Andhra Pradesh and Telangana. Preliminary reports identified Sridhar from Kadapa and Jayashree from Machilipatnam among those who lost their lives, while four more tourists from Andhra Pradesh remain unaccounted for.
According to initial information, the group was part of a corporate tour organised by a mobile phone distribution company that had taken around 250 distributors to Vietnam. The delegation reportedly included about 35 participants from Andhra Pradesh and 40 from Telangana. Rescue and search operations are underway, and authorities are working to trace the missing passengers while extending assistance to the affected families.
